## Divestiture of the Marrow Lane Unit (Managers Only)

Pendrick Holdings has agreed to sell its Marrow Lane fabrication unit to Ostervale Group, pending regulatory clearance expected within ninety days. The unit's 140 staff transfer to the buyer under existing terms; branch managers should not comment externally. Orders in progress will be fulfilled under a six-month service agreement, and the Tilbrook warehouse remains with Pendrick. Customer notifications go out after closing. The broader rationale for the transaction is recorded below.

confidential, kagup-bafog: Fraaxax Group is in early talks to buy Soroxox Group for about $343.8 million. The Olidor launch date is June 14, and nothing goes to the press before then. Legal wants the Aldmirek Logistics term sheet signed before July 23.

Break-glass access: SquatWatch

Quick notes for the weekly sync. SquatWatch is our typo-squatting package scanner; if it goes dark, malicious lookalike packages can slip into the Pellbrook registry, so we keep a break-glass path. Use it only when both regular admins are unreachable and the scanner has been down 30+ minutes. Grab the sealed envelope from the ops locker, log the incident in #squatwatch-alerts, and ping whoever's on call. The break-glass login prompts for the passphrase below.

unlock words, tagaf-tawif: quenys-zordor-aldius-caswyn

## FAQ: Why do large spreadsheet exports use so much memory?

The Ledgerly export service builds the entire workbook in memory before compressing it, so exports above 25k rows can spike the worker heap. Use the paginated export endpoint for large datasets; it streams in chunks. If an export job is killed repeatedly, file a ticket or contact the export team at the address below.

alerts address for bawif-hahig: norwyn_gorys_lamath@olvarqlabs.test

When customers report that identical exports from the Reportal builder show rows in different orders, check whether the grouping column contains duplicate keys. Reportal's in-memory sort is stable only when the secondary tiebreaker is enabled in the tenant config; otherwise equal keys may shuffle between runs. Before escalating to the Quillmark platform team, confirm the tenant flag, re-run the export twice, and compare row hashes. If the order still drifts, capture the trace token below and attach it to the ticket.

build token for haduf-bafog: htk21_2d98ce91a83676b65394a